Craftgifts.ie Returns, Cancellations and Exchanges

CraftGifts.ie is an online marketplace through which independent sellers offer products for sale. Unless otherwise stated on the product or order page, the seller identified in your order is the trader responsible for supplying the goods and dealing with cancellations, returns and statutory remedies. CraftGifts.ie may facilitate communications and return requests between customers and sellers.

1. Your Right to Cancel

We hope you are delighted with your purchase. However, where you purchase eligible goods online as a consumer, you generally have the right to change your mind and cancel the contract without giving a reason.

For most eligible goods purchased through CraftGifts.ie, the cancellation period expires 14 days after the day on which you, or a person nominated by you other than the carrier, receives the goods.

Where one order contains several goods delivered separately, the cancellation period will generally run from the day on which the last item is received.

After notifying the seller that you wish to cancel, you must return the goods without undue delay and no later than 14 days after giving that notification.

The statutory cancellation right does not apply to certain excluded products, including some personalised, custom-made, perishable and hygiene-sensitive goods.

2. How to Request a Cancellation or Return

You may submit a return request through your CraftGifts.ie account:

  1. Log in to the account used to place the order.
  2. Open Account > Orders.
  3. Select the relevant order.
  4. Choose Request a replacement or a refund, where available.
  5. Complete the request and follow the return instructions provided.

You may also exercise your cancellation right by sending the seller, or CraftGifts.ie for transmission to the seller, a clear statement explaining that you wish to cancel the contract. You do not have to use the online return-request system, provided your cancellation is communicated within the applicable cancellation period.

Please do not send goods back until you have received the appropriate return address and instructions.

Where a return arises solely because you have changed your mind, you will normally be responsible for the direct cost of returning the goods, provided you were informed of that responsibility before purchasing.

3. Condition of Returned Goods

You may inspect goods to the extent reasonably necessary to establish their nature, characteristics and functioning, in much the same way as you could examine them in a physical shop.

You may be responsible for any reduction in value caused by handling the goods beyond what is reasonably necessary for that purpose.

Returned goods should therefore be kept in good condition and, where reasonably possible, returned with their original packaging, components and accessories. The absence of original packaging does not, by itself, remove a statutory cancellation right.

4. Refunds Following Cancellation

Where you validly exercise the statutory right to cancel, the seller must reimburse the payments due to you, including the cost of the least expensive standard delivery option offered when you placed the order.

Any additional amount paid because you selected a more expensive delivery method does not have to be refunded.

Reimbursement must be made without undue delay and normally no later than 14 days after the seller is informed of your decision to cancel.

Where goods must be returned, reimbursement may be withheld until the seller has received the goods back or you have provided evidence that they were returned, whichever occurs first.

Refunds will normally be issued using the same payment method used for the original transaction unless another method is expressly agreed. You should not incur a fee solely because the payment is being refunded.

5. Goods Excluded from the Change-of-Mind Cancellation Right

The statutory cooling-off right may not apply to certain products, including:

  • Goods made to your individual specifications.
  • Clearly personalised goods, including certain engraved, monogrammed or custom-designed products.
  • Goods liable to deteriorate or expire rapidly, including certain foods, flowers and other perishable products.
  • Sealed goods that are unsuitable for return for health-protection or hygiene reasons where the seal has been broken after delivery.
  • Sealed audio recordings, video recordings or computer software where the seal has been broken after delivery.
  • Certain newspapers, periodicals and magazines.
  • Other goods or contracts excluded from the statutory cancellation right under applicable law.
Important: These exclusions apply to change-of-mind cancellations. They do not remove your statutory rights where goods are faulty, damaged, incorrect or not as described.

6. Damaged, Faulty, Incorrect or Non-Conforming Goods

Please inspect your order as soon as reasonably possible after delivery. Contact the seller through CraftGifts.ie promptly if an item arrives damaged, is faulty, is incorrect or does not conform to its description or the contract.

Your rights in relation to non-conforming goods are separate from the 14-day change-of-mind cancellation right. Those rights are not lost merely because an issue was not reported within 24 hours.

Depending on the nature of the problem, when it becomes apparent and the applicable statutory requirements, remedies may include:

  • A short-term right to terminate the contract and obtain a refund.
  • Repair.
  • Replacement.
  • A proportionate reduction in price.
  • A final right to terminate the contract and obtain a refund.

Repair or replacement must be provided free of charge, within a reasonable time and without significant inconvenience where the consumer is entitled to that remedy.

Where goods are faulty or non-conforming through no fault of the customer, the customer will not be required to bear costs that applicable consumer law places on the seller.

7. Exchanges

Exchanges for non-faulty goods are available only where the individual seller agrees to provide one or where an exchange policy is stated on the relevant product or seller page.

Where a discretionary exchange is agreed because the customer has changed their mind, the customer may be responsible for:

  • The cost of returning the original item.
  • The cost of delivering the replacement item.
  • Any price difference between the original and replacement products.

This does not affect statutory rights relating to faulty, damaged, incorrect or otherwise non-conforming goods.
